Kingsolver’s powerful novel, released in 2022, is a detailed retelling of Charles Dickens’s “David Copperfield” set in contemporary Appalachia. The story gallops as a result of concerns together with childhood poverty, opioid addiction and rural dispossession whilst its larger target stays squarely over the query of how an artist’s consciousness is shaped.

Set over a cherry orchard through the recent pandemic, this novel has echoes of both equally Anton Chekhov and Thornton Wilder. It follows three sisters inside their 20s quarantining with their mom and drawing out stories read more from her previous as an actress.
